I have a small, one panel, solar setup running an off-grid irrigation system in rural France. For the past few years this system has utilised two 12v leisure batteries to run a couple of 24v dc pumps. The batteries are reaching the end of their life so I decided to upgrade to lifepo4, and have managed to pick up a second-hand Pylontech UP2500 24v unit. My question, can I simply swap out the old lead batteries for the Pylontech battery. I am using a Renogy Rover MPPT charge controller.

Generally yes a direct swap.
Best if the equalization can be disabled and possibly adjust the charging and float voltages to meet the battery specifications.
